Government won't adopt Liberal policy critics warned could hurt press freedom, PM says

Days after Prime Minister Justin Trudeau made a keynote address at the 2023 Liberal National Convention in Ottawa, he said the government would never implement a Liberal Party policy resolution that critics argued could hurt press freedom.

The representative from Meta said the company is working on blocking news on Facebook and Instagram from Canadian users if Bill C-18, which tech giants have fought against, passes. The bill first tabled in June 2022 would force digital giants to negotiate deals that would compensate Canadian media companies, potentially including the CBC, for linking to or repurposing their online content.
